Sign In Register Forgot User ID? Forgot Password?Trailer & Equipment Tires
197 products
These tires replace old or worn tires on trailers, sporting vehicles, and equipment such as lawnmowers and garden tractors. Tires should be matched to the type of vehicle or equipment and the driving terrain.
Street Tires
These street tires provide a smooth ride and traction for higher speeds, and are intended for sporting vehicles and trailers that run on paved roads. They are approved by the Department of Transportation (DOT) for use on streets and highways and are primarily used for golf carts and trailers.

Off-Road Tires
The tread depths and patterns of these off-road tires support equipment that runs on rough terrain such as loose gravel, and rocky or muddy dirt roads. Also referred to as all-terrain tires, they are not approved by the Department of Transportation (DOT) to drive on streets and highways. They are primarily used for landscaping equipment and off-road sporting vehicles.
